Recommended Feb 17, 2017
What a wonderful game. It's so different from everything I've ever played, which makes it so compelling, too. Figuring out the controls takes a bit of patience, but once I understood, I got really into it. You play as a grey entity / alien that captures humans in the woods. We don't really know why, but it gives you a new perspective, and it's not that easy (humans are fast, and some carry guns). It's not a fast paced game unless you make it one. Capturing humans is stressful business! Especially in the beginning. You are surrounded by an orb that seems to expand the more humans you catch. The size of the orb determines how close you have to get to the human in order to catch them. I also unlocked an ability that made me faster. They run away from you, so if you don't want to catch them it gives you time to just soak up the environment and it's really beautiful to look at. I saw spiders, bunnies, all sorts of insects and butterflies.. the attention to detail made me stop and stare at everything for a moment. The music is also really good.

Not recommended Apr 19, 2026
The pixel art is a bit messy but fairly rich in details (especially little animals in the woods), I like the visualization of the ship and the introduction. The soundtrack is really good. The big issue is that it's really boring. It gets easier as the player progresses, as thankfully the capture range becomes increasingly larger on top of abilities to move through the screen faster, but doesn't change that the titular character's normal movement is slow, with clunky controls, and all it can do is use those abilities to get humans in range, capture, rinse and repeat over all the areas that, while nicely characterized, are all within some national park in North America. There is not even a story or an apparent reason for the player's actions - you are an alien, and so of course you abduct humans.
